The "Timoshenko" name is also synonymous with an advanced beam theory. The , developed with his collaborator Paul Ehrenfest between 1911-1912, corrects a key limitation of the classical Euler-Bernoulli beam theory for short, thick beams. The Euler-Bernoulli theory assumes that a beam's cross-sections remain perfectly perpendicular to its axis during bending. Timoshenko's model accounts for the effects of transverse shear deformation and rotary inertia, making it more accurate for analyzing stocky beams and high-frequency vibrations.
